425 Park Blvd #2062, Ogden, Ut 84401 is where Glenn resides. Glenn was born in 1959. Glenn owns the phone number (801) 363-4648. The current age of Glenn is 65. Glenn has previously lived in Salt Lake City, Ogden and Roy. Glenn's possible relatives are Henry L Gallegos, Debra L Seiber, David Paul Seiber and one other person.